Coast Enna Dress ($195)

I wore this dress to a graduation lunch this weekend, and I loved it.  Apparently, a lot of people on Instagram did too.  So I thought I would post it here, because while it is a bit pricey at almost-$200, I think it was worth every penny.  It’s the perfect evening work event/business attire cocktail party dress that I have ever seen.

Looking for an ivory dress that costs under-$100?  I like this Ralph Lauren pleated dress, the structured cap sleeve dress is also lovely and I love the woven sleeves on this dress.  And if you are looking for something with a longer sleeve, try this v-neck dress or this gorgeous, simple sheath.

Plus size? I like this $45 dress with bell sleeves.  Petite? This belted cap sleeve dress is lovely.
